West Metro Garage addition and Upgrade
West Metro Garage addition and Upgrade
Xpand Inc. | Homes of XcellenceXpand Inc. | Homes of Xcellence
At the outset, this project began with the transformation of a 2-car attached garage. The goal was to create a mudroom, an exercise room, and a breezeway to seamlessly connect the spacious detached garage with the main part of the house. Additionally, the project involved partial roof removal and the addition of a new front entry. But then came an unexpected twist – scope creep. We found ourselves veering away from the initial client-supplied architectural plans. After numerous consultations with the clients and several iterations of the design, we arrived at a significantly improved plan for the remodel and addition. Our journey commenced with the demolition of almost the entire former 2-car garage, making space for a new, oversized 3-car garage measuring 40′ x 28′. This garage was strategically placed between the existing house and the large detached garage. We introduced a custom low-sloped flat roof, designed to address historical drainage issues. To mitigate water pooling, we created a custom concrete step at the back corner of the garage, equipped with a sturdy metal grate that sits flush with the step. We also installed a PVC drainage system, commencing at the step and running beneath a newly designed patio, ultimately draining into the yard. These measures have significantly reduced water accumulation around the house. The new garage boasts several features, including Longboard aluminum siding, custom full glass garage doors, interior drywall finished to a level 4, an abundance of can lights, an epoxy floor coating, vinyl base trim, a new forced air garage heater, and more. The clients also requested a designated space for their three kids and their friends to enjoy, thus giving birth to the “Kid Zone.” We partitioned a section of the existing oversized garage, resulting in a space measuring approximately 22′ x 32′, brimming with entertainment possibilities. To enhance control over the temperature in the Kid Zone, we collaborated with our licensed HVAC partner to install a cold weather mini-split system. One of the most significant challenges was the modernization and consolidation of the home’s main electrical systems. We reconfigured and combined 6-7 different electrical panels into just two. One panel serves the main house, while the second is dedicated to backup power from a generator. These panels, along with the boiler for the in-floor heating system, are housed in a newly constructed mechanical room within the Kid Zone. Inside the main house, we completed various tasks, such as removing the ceiling in the hallway from the new garage to address prior water damage, improve insulation, and rework electrical and HVAC systems. We also replaced the ceiling from the front door to the base of the stairs, adding new can lighting and enhancing insulation. Skilled drywall specialists then installed and finished new drywall to a level 5 standard. The exterior of the house underwent a complete overhaul. Before installing new roofing on the entire house and garage, we modified an existing flat roof by adding custom lumber and plywood to enhance the pitch, preventing future ice dams. A new rubber roof was expertly installed on the oversized 3-car garage, and the flat roof section we re-framed. Our meticulous exterior team removed old white aluminum soffit, fascia, and gutters, replacing them with new framing to accommodate Longboard soffit material. This task was particularly challenging due to the age of the house and the non-standard wall and roof framing. Our skilled exterior subcontractors ensured a perfect fit. Near the pool area, we discovered severe rot and decay from years of water intrusion. After informing the homeowners, we ordered and installed five new commercial-style block framed windows and a custom 8′ high Anderson patio door. This involved careful removal and replacement of window headers from the outside to avoid disturbing the finished part of the house. We reframed the large openings to fit the new windows, and our skilled trim carpenters installed new walnut casing, base, and window sills. In total, we replaced around 900 lineal feet of soffit and installed approximately 32 squares of aluminum siding. The entire house was meticulously prepped, repaired, and painted according to the client’s chosen color. Throughout the project, we incorporated numerous custom touches and unique design elements, some of which you can see in the pictures. Our team also addressed various unforeseen challenges, from soil issues to rot and decay repair, roof leaks, drainage problems, electrical and HVAC complexities, and much more. Roadside House
Roadside House
中佐昭夫/ナフ・アーキテクト&デザイン中佐昭夫/ナフ・アーキテクト&デザイン
前面道路から敷地内へと枝分かれする私道をつくり、私道に向かって間口の広い大屋根の住宅をつくった。 私道はアスファルトで仕上げ、実際は庭でありながら一般的な道路と同じ雰囲気にしている。近所の人と気兼ねなく立ち話をしたり、子供がチョークで絵を描いて遊んだり、来客時には駐車場としても使える、いわば「占用できる道路」を想定した。 敷地は新潟市の歴史の古い地域にあり、そこでは喧嘩灯籠で知られるお祭りが伝統になっている。お祭りの会場は道路で、その際には車両が通行止めになる。お祭りが近づくと、ご近所同士が道路に集まって灯籠の修繕や会議を始め、そのまま酒宴になることもあるとか。この地域では、もともと道路が生活空間の一部として利用されているような雰囲気があり、「占用できる道路」という考え方は、そういった状況を引き継いでいる。 1階にはガレージ、ダイニング・キッチン、リビング、土間があり、それぞれ開口部を介して私道と直接のやり取りができるようになっている。例えば近所の人がお裾分けを持ってくると、玄関まで行かなくてもダイニング・キッチンの窓からのやり取りで事足りる。車好きな知人がやってくると、ガレージから出て行って駐車を先導し、車談義を始められる。私道の一番奥にある玄関は広い土間になっていて、お祭りの準備や打ち上げの会場に使える。 2階にはサンルーム、洗面・浴室、寝室、客間があり、私道から隔てられたプライベートな場所としている。雨が多く晴天が少ない新潟では、室内で過ごす時間が長くなりがちなので、サンルームは大屋根の棟の高さを利用した開放的な空間とした。そこは日当りが良く、洗濯物干し場や子供の遊び場として使えるフリースペースであり、さらに洗面・浴室へガラス入りの欄間を通して自然光を届ける光溜まりでもある。寝室や客間は大屋根の軒に近い所に配置し、天井が低い小ぢんまりした空間とした。 法規上は西側接道だが、敷地内の私道を前面道路のように扱うことで擬似的な南側接道とし、より多くの採光を得られるようにしている。また、東西に長く南北に短い建物とすることで、日射負荷を軽減し、風通しを良くしている。
